0.9.18.12: valid/already-dumped confusion in the file compiler/
[sbcl.git] / src / compiler / life.lisp
index 6502bc2..8d81428 100644 (file)
                   (setf (svref (ir2-block-local-tns block1)
                                (global-conflicts-number current))
                         nil)
-                  (setf (global-conflicts-number current) nil)
-                  (setf (tn-current-conflict tn) current))
+                  (setf (global-conflicts-number current) nil))
                  (t
                   (setf (sbit live-in (global-conflicts-number current)) 1)))
+               (setf (tn-current-conflict tn) current)
                (return)))))
         (:write)))
     did-something))